The evolution of special effects seen in the movies:
1900 - The Enchanted Drawing, 1903 - The Great Train Robbery,1923 - The Ten Commandments (Silent), 1927 - Sunrise, 1933 - King Kong, 1939 - The Wizard of Oz, 1940 - The Thief of Bagdad, 1954 - 20,000 Leagues Under the Sea, 1956 - Forbidden Planet, 1963 - Jason and the Argonauts, 1964 - Mary Poppins, 1977 - Star Wars, 1982 - Tron, 1985 - Back to the Future, 1988 - Who Framed Roger Rabbit, 1989 - The Abyss, 1991 - Terminator 2: Judgement Day, 1992 - The Young Indiana Jones, Chronicles, 1993 - Jurassic Park, 2004 - Spider-Man 2, 2005 - King Kong, 2006 - Pirates of the Caribbean: Dead Man’s Chest, 2007 - Pirates of the Caribbean: At World’s End, 2007 - The Golden Compass, 2008 - The Spiderwick Chronicles, 2008 - The Curious Case of Benjamin Button
